WANG YI DONG

Wang Yidong 

 

1955

Born in the Yimeng Mountain area of Shandong Province, China

1982

Graduated from the Central Academy of Fine Art, Beijing and has been teaching there ever since

Known for his portrait studies, in particular, people of his native regions

Regarded as one of the representatives of Chinese Oil Portraits in the modern era

Award

In 1984, he won the Golden Prize of the Sixth National Art Exhibition organized in the National Gallery, Beijing

Collection

His painting The Old Village is in the collection of China National Art Gallery
